Russia-Ukraine Conflict Impacts US Economy, Foreign Policy

As Russia’s invasion of Ukraine dominates the headlines, oil prices broke above 100 dollars for the first time since 2014, natural gas prices increased by 6.5 percent, and stock markets dropped globally.
